Security issues remain a top priority for our nation’s truck-related operations. The truck renting and leasing industry places strong emphasis on security measures, both through TRALA and individual companies. TRALA is committed to the enhancement and promotion of security measures within the truck renting and leasing industry.
TRALA Security Program
TRALA has a permanent Truck Security Committee that serves as both an information clearinghouse on security matters and in an advisory capacity to the TRALA leadership. TRALA maintains regular contact on security issues with government agencies and officials, particularly the Transportation Security Administration (TSA) within the Department of Homeland Security (DHS). Through relationships with key federal and state agencies, TRALA shares security information reciprocally and provides important TSA security bulletins to its members.

Truck Rental Employee Guide
Safeguarding America’s Transportation System, Security Guide for Truck Rental Employees was prepared by the federal government with input from TRALA, is part of a cooperative effort to heighten security awareness within the truck rental industry. The guide identifies certain behaviors and actions that employees of truck rental companies should be on the lookout for during the workday.

TRALA Security Awareness and Self Assessment Guide
Truck Renting and Leasing Security Awareness and Self-Assessment Guide is a voluntary tool for companies to use when assessing their security preparedness. The awareness information and self-assessment inquiries in the guide were developed with the help of expert security consultants and in consultation with the federal Transportation Security Administration (TSA).
